## Runbook: Gaugepile Sidecar — Release Checklist

Heads up: the sidecar ships with every app pod, so a bad config fans out fast. Before cutting a release, confirm the flush interval hasn't drifted from what the Tallyhouse aggregator expects, or you'll see sawtooth gaps in dashboards. Rollbacks are cheap — just repin the image tag. Canary one node pool first, watch for ten minutes, then proceed. The values to verify against are these.

config for bagep-yafof:
quenath:
  pin: 8584
  metrics_host: metrics.quenath.tolvaqsys.internal
  tenant: pelath
  seal: seal_ed102645

Catalogue import, step 3: stop the Quillbarrow indexer before touching records. Verify the Marrowfield feed snapshot matches last night's checksum, then stage it under /imports/pending. The importer authenticates to the feed with a shared secret read from importer.env; append it on the line directly below this sentence.

sealed setting: ARCHIVE_KEY3=8d0

Sales leads, please review carefully before Thursday's session. The new subscription tier bundles priority onboarding, the Cartwheel analytics module, and quarterly strategy reviews, priced roughly 40% above the standard plan. Early soundings with the Bryden and Oakfell accounts suggest strong appetite, though churn risk on the mid-tier needs modelling. Do not discuss pricing externally until legal clears the terms. The strategic note appended below is confidential and should inform your pipeline conversations only.

confidential, kagep-kahof: Druokax Systems plans to lower the Ulaath list price by 53 percent in March.